How RBC Capital Markets revamped its data management efforts

Bank Innovation

RBC Capital Markets has looked externally to help it consolidate data in one place, analyze it and better equip employees. Starting in 2013, RBC Capital Markets began collecting all the data it could that was relevant to its clients, including e-commerce data, trades and portfolios.

Oracle Debuts New Tech To Optimize Capital

PYMNTS

Oracle is offering a new supply chain finance feature to help banks access more flexible financing options and working capital, a press release says. With Oracle Banking Supply Chain’s fully digitized processing and real-time analytics, banks can help corporates further optimize working capital and liquidity in their supply chains.”.
